> Hello,
> I have found a problem with a ConcurrentModificationException in the class 'org.apache.axis2.context.ConfigurationContext' of the Axis2-kernel. In my test-case, I work with a stateful webservice in session-scope and the addressing-module included.
> My service-xml looks like this:
> <serviceGroup>
> <service
> name="Beratungsservice"
> class="de.is2.web.beratungsservice.service.BeratungsserviceLifeCycle"
> scope="soapsession"
> >
> <description>Beratungsservice</description>
> <module ref="addressing"/>
> <messageReceivers>
> <messageReceiver
> mep="http://www.w3.org/2004/08/wsdl/in-out"
> class="de.is2.web.gen.beratungsservice.service.BeratungsserviceMessageReceiverInOut"
> />
> </messageReceivers>
> <schema schemaNamespace="http://is2.de/prototype/Beratungsservice"/>
> <parameter name="ServiceClass">de.is2.web.beratungsservice.service.Beratungsservice</parameter>
> <parameter name="modifyUserWSDLPortAddress">true</parameter>
> <parameter name="Traeger_RootConfig">/rootconfig.xml</parameter>
> </service>
> </serviceGroup>
> The session-timeout in axis2.xml is set to 30 seconds (default).
> To test the service, I am using 30 client-threads, which send parallel calls to the service.
> private static void testMultiCall() {
> for(int index = 0; index < 30; index++) {
> try {
> Thread.sleep(100);
> }
> catch (InterruptedException oEx) {
> oEx.printStackTrace();
> }
> try {
> new Thread(new TestRunner(index), "T" + index).start();
> }
> catch (Throwable e) {
> e.printStackTrace();
> }
> }
> }
> Sometimes, I get ConcurrentModificationException on server-side as shown below:

> The exception is thrown in the method 'cleanupServiceGroupContexts()' at the line 'String sgCtxtId = (String) sgCtxtMapKeyIter.next();'
> private void cleanupServiceGroupContexts() {
> if (serviceGroupContextMap == null) {
> return;
> }
> long currentTime = new Date().getTime();
> for (Iterator sgCtxtMapKeyIter = serviceGroupContextMap.keySet().iterator();
> sgCtxtMapKeyIter.hasNext();) {
> String sgCtxtId = (String) sgCtxtMapKeyIter.next();
> ServiceGroupContext serviceGroupContext =
> (ServiceGroupContext) serviceGroupContextMap.get(sgCtxtId);
> if ((currentTime - serviceGroupContext.getLastTouchedTime()) >
> getServiceGroupContextTimoutInterval()) {
> sgCtxtMapKeyIter.remove();
> cleanupServiceContexts(serviceGroupContext);
> contextRemoved(serviceGroupContext);
> }
> }
> }
> When ever a new session is established, the axis-kernel checks the context for timed-out sessions an perform a clean-up.
> It seems, that the reason for the problem is the iterator of the keyset, which is not synchronised and thus, not prepared for multiple modification in different threads.
> In my tests, I have temporary modified the method 'cleanupServiceGroupContexts()' and synchronized the member 'serviceGroupContextMap' as following:
> private void cleanupServiceGroupContexts() {
> if (serviceGroupContextMap == null) {
> return;
> }
> long currentTime = new Date().getTime();
>
> synchronized (serviceGroupContextMap) {
>
> for (Iterator sgCtxtMapKeyIter = serviceGroupContextMap.keySet().iterator();
> sgCtxtMapKeyIter.hasNext();) {
> String sgCtxtId = (String) sgCtxtMapKeyIter.next();
> ServiceGroupContext serviceGroupContext =
> (ServiceGroupContext) serviceGroupContextMap.get(sgCtxtId);
> if ((currentTime - serviceGroupContext.getLastTouchedTime()) >
> getServiceGroupContextTimoutInterval()) {
> sgCtxtMapKeyIter.remove();
> cleanupServiceContexts(serviceGroupContext);
> contextRemoved(serviceGroupContext);
> }
> }
> }
> }
> That synchronisation seems to solve the problem and no more ConcurrentModificationException are thrown.
